Signage & Graphics Artworker/Designer Egham Salary 28k- 32k DOE Hours Mon-Fri 8:30am-5:00pm My client is a leader in designing, manufacturing, and installing high-quality signage solutions that help businesses stand out. With a strong commitment to creativity, precision, and customer satisfaction, they specialize in delivering impactful signage for diverse industries. They are looking for a technical artworker / designer to join their busy signage and graphics business. Reporting directly to the Senior Team, you will be responsible for accurately creating artwork from concept to completion. The workload is varied on a day-to-day basis; almost every job is different, which makes the workdays very exciting! The job role predominantly consists of creating artwork for proof approval and production processes; following client brand guidelines or survey specifications, ensuring that all images and files are scaled and print ready. You'll get to see how each job works their way through multiple production processes including wall graphics, internal and external signage, manifestation, large format, and small format printing. There are many processes to be learned, so the ability to digest a lot of information is necessary to hit the ground running. The majority of design work is more of a technical nature where accuracy and attention to detail is crucial. The role would suit a candidate at a junior to middleweight level with flair and willingness to make the role their own. SKILLS/ KNOWLEDGE You'll need to be highly organised and great at managing your own workload, be diverse and capable of switching your focus quickly and efficiently on multiple projects. You must be confident dealing with all colleagues from the Managing Director to designers, production and fitting staff. As well as dealing with customers via phone, email and in person - you need to have a good phone manner and come across professionally. A conscientious attitude to work; with excellent attention to detail, ensuring all artwork is proofread and produced to exact requirements. You must be proficient in Adobe Illustrator; speed and efficiency are essential. Other program knowledge of Photoshop, InDesign, Acrobat with excellent literacy skills both written and numerically.
